    INTRODUCTION

     Immunofluorescence (IF) is an important immunochemical technique that allows detection and localization of a wide variety of antigens in different types of tissues of various cell preparations. There are two classes of immunofluorescence techniques, primary (or direct) and secondary (or indirect).

     

    Immunofluorescence can be used on tissue sections, cultured cell lines, or individual cells, and may be used to analyse the distribution of proteins, glycans, and small biological and non-biological molecules. This technique can even be used to visualise structures such as intermediate-sized filaments.

     

    Immunofluorescence assay (IFA) is a standard virologic technique to identify the presence of antibodies by their specific ability to react with viral antigens expressed in infected cells; bound antibodies are visualised by incubation with fluorescently labelled anti human antibody.

     

    The principle behind the Immunoassay test is the use of an antibody that will specifically bind to the antigen of interest. The antibodies used in the Immunoassay must have a high affinity for the antigen. The antibodies used in the Immunoassay can either be monoclonal or polyclonal antibodies.

    Getein 1600 Immunofluorescence Quantitative Analyzer.Getein 1600 Immunofluorescence Quantitative Analyzer (hereinafter called Getein 1600) is a fully-automatic bench-top diagnostic analyzer. Combined together with bar-coded, ready-to-use strip cassettes, Getein 1600 is designed to deliver accurate testing results in minutes.

     

    In conjunction with dedicated test kits of Immunofluorescence, the instrument automates the detection and quantification of markers for cardiovascular disease, renal diseases, inflammation, fertility, diabetes mellitus, bone metabolism, tumour and thyroid in a biological sample.
